USSA-DUFC takes soccer from recreational play to the next level of competitive play. The primary goal of the program is to develop high quality players who can compete at the local, state, and national levels.

Letter from the new Coaching Coordinator
by posted 05/23/2013
 
Dear USSA-DUFC Parents,
 
I wanted to share with you the club's current status and inform you of some recent events. First, USSA-DUFC will not be merging with the Chicago Fire Juniors South. As some of you know Jose Smith USSA-DUFC's former Coaching Coordinator has resigned his position as Coaching Coordinator and has informed the board that he will be leaving the club at the conclusion of the Spring Season. As a result, many have wondered what would become of his responsibilities and especially the 5 teams in which he provided specific oversight; two u 8 teams, u 9 girls team, u 10 boys team. He also provided some leadership for our U 11 boys’ team and U 12 and U13 teams. His departure from the club is a difficult one for the club, kids and families. I wanted to inform all of you that I have decided take on the role of Coaching Coordinator/ Director of Coaching for the remainder of this Spring and into the new season. I love USSA-DUFC and think our area needs a local club that will provide quality training without the huge price tag. If you are curious what my qualifications are to fulfill this duty please feel free to look at my bio on our club websitehttp://www.ussa-dufc.com/Page.asp?n=40770&snid=dMICY4E%3FW&org=ussa-dufc.com
The purpose of this letter however is not to discuss my qualifications, but rather to inform you that all other staff coaches intend to remain with the club for the fall and I have recruited coaching staff to fill any other coaching needs. I will assume the duties of Coaching Coordinator making sure our staff coaches have training plans when needed, have opportunities for coaching development through licensing and most importantly that our kids improve in their skill while learning to love the game of soccer. Finally, I wanted to let you all know that USSA-DUFC Tryouts will be held the week of June 3-7 at Dynamo Fields. The tryouts will be held on the day and time of your regularly schedule practice with the only difference being its location, Dynamo fields located off of Bethel drive in Bourbonnais. All the coaches have already been notified of this change. The tryouts will be run like a normal practice with a couple of differences. All kids in attendance will be evaluated by one of our staff coaches and at the end of the second day of tryouts will be given individualized feedback. Parents will also be able to meet their coach for the fall and ask questions of them and of the board members present. You will also be able to pick registration forms for the fall season and register at the time if you like. It is important to understand that USSA-DUFC will need to have all registrations in with $75 down payments by the end of June.

USSA-DUFC 2012-2013 Season
by posted 06/15/2012
 
USSA-DUFC
 
River Valley’s Premier Youth Futbol/Soccer Club in the south Suburbs of Chicago
 

 
USSA-DUFC Benefits:
 
  • Year round competitive program for youth players U8-U19
  • Nationally licensed coaches/trainers
  • Unlimited training
  • Players develop confidence and character
  • Providing lifelong friendships
  • College recruiting
 
Pre-Academy (4-6 year olds) Boys and Girls Program 
 
 Fall season [Aug. to Nov.]      Training: 1 time per week
                                          Games:    2 scrimmage games
                                                  
 Winter season [Nov. to Apr]   Training: 1 time per week
                                                                        Games:   2-4 scrimmage games [two indoor seasons]
                                                 
Spring season [Apr. to June]    Training: 1 time per week
                                         Games:    2 scrimmage games
                                                           
 
U8-U19 Boys and Girls Program  
(pro-rated fee for partial year available)
Fall season [Aug. to Nov.]       Training:  2 times per week
                                           Games:    10 League games                                     
                                                  Events:    1 Tournament
Winter season [Nov. to Apr]    Training: 1 time per week
                                          Games:   16 to 18 games [two indoor seasons]
                                                  Events:    1 Tournament
Spring season [Apr. to June]    Training:  2 times per week
                                               Games:    8 League games
                                                  Events:    1 Tournament
